Automates clash detection process

The circulation of MEP components, for example, ventilation work, electrical hardware, plumbing water pipes, VAV boxes and so on makes development projects complex. It additionally brings about various struggles in MEP coordination.

BIM (Building Data Modeling) based MEP coordination frameworks computerize the coordination and clash discovery process by distinguishing delicate clashes, hard clashes and work process impedances at the pre-development stage. This saves many worker hours expected for the manual interaction.
